Hi Devon, welcome to the Mailforge on-call rotation. Quick heads-up on batch email digest scheduling: digests fire at 06:00 local per region, and the scheduler is intentionally single-threaded to avoid duplicate sends. If a batch stalls, don't just re-kick it — check the dedupe ledger first, or users get double digests and we get angry tickets. Pager thresholds, the restart procedure, and escalation order are all documented on the internal page.

runbook for badug-kadup: https://confluence.zemvarlabs.internal/projects/browse/display/projects/bd1b

# Sensor drift compensation for the Verdanix greenhouse controller.
# Humidity probes in bays 3–7 drift roughly 0.4% per week, so this
# client fetches recalibration offsets from the internal CalibraCore
# service every six hours rather than trusting raw readings.
# Reviewer: the credential is scoped read-only to the offsets
# endpoint and nothing else. The client authenticates to CalibraCore
# using the key defined on the next line.

service key, fawip-bajef: kto11_Qt5wZK9vdNC

### Account Recovery — Catalogue Import (Lintwood)

Quick one for review: when the Lintwood catalogue import wipes a patron's session table, the recovery flow re-seeds accounts from the nightly snapshot. Check that the importer skips locked accounts — last time it didn't. To rerun recovery against staging you'll need the vault passphrase, which is appended just below.

recovery phrase for yafof-tajof: julmir-kelax-julvan-holath-belvan-holir-ralael-ralvan-ralath-julvan-silmir-istmir-kaswyn-ulamir